首页> 外国专利> IMPROVED FLOW REGULATING SYSTEM FOR SUPPLYING PROPELLANT FLUID TO AN ELECTRIC THRUSTER OF A SPACE VEHICLE

IMPROVED FLOW REGULATING SYSTEM FOR SUPPLYING PROPELLANT FLUID TO AN ELECTRIC THRUSTER OF A SPACE VEHICLE

机译:用于向空间电动助推器供应推进剂流体的改进的流量调节系统

摘要

A system for regulating the flow of a propellant fluid for an electric thruster of a space vehicle, comprising a propellant fluid reservoir and a flow regulator mounted at the outlet of said reservoir, the flow regulator comprising a heating element controlled by a computer and designed to heat the propellant fluid and modify the physical properties thereof in order to vary the flow of propellant fluid exiting the reservoir, said system being characterised in that the computer further comprises a plurality of empirically determined empirical calibration curves defining the flow of propellant fluid depending on the intensity of heating and environmental parameters, such that said computer also performs a function of determining the flow of propellant fluid.
